Tuesday's Dateline: Syria's Freedom Fighters

SBS's Dateline gets behind the rebel frontline in Syria to report on a rarely-seen side of the conflict with the Assad government.

Over 6,000 people are said to have been killed since the Syrian Government started its crackdown on protests against President Assad's regime.

The violence has brought worldwide condemnation and calls from the UN to end the 'violations of human rights'.

Tuesday's Dateline on SBS ONE at 9.30pm goes undercover in Homs with a group of rebel fighters, led by a charismatic 25-year-old deserter from Assad's army.

In a rarely-seen side of the conflict, the story captures life behind the frontline with the Free Syria Army, as the rebels patrol the ruined streets, dodging snipers' bullets, as they try to stop the advance of Assad's forces.
